East San Gabriel, Temple City,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in East San Gabriel?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| East San Gabriel Studio Apartments | $2,158 | $1,485 | $2,954 |
| East San Gabriel 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,561 | $1,800 | $5,150 |
| East San Gabriel 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,357 | $2,103 | $4,695 |
| East San Gabriel 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,395 | $2,495 | $4,192 |
| East San Gabriel 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,400 | $4,400 | $4,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about East San Gabriel
How much are Studio apartments in East San Gabriel?
There are currently 233 Studio Apartments in East San Gabriel with rent ranges from $1,485 to $2,954 with an average price of $2,158.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om East San Gabriel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in East San Gabriel ranges from $1,800 to $5,150 with an average monthly rent of $2,561.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in East San Gabriel c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in East San Gabriel range from $2,103 to $4,695.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,357.
How expensive are East San Gabriel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 130 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in East San Gabriel on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,495 to $4,192 - averaging $3,395 for the location.
